I'm looking into getting a Norco Sasquatch. I'm around 5'8". I have a limited choice since I'm buying used. An 18" or a 20". What should I go with. I only plan on keeping the bike for a year and I'm not really growing anymore. I figured I'd go with the smaller so I could get a more laidback feeling on the bike which adds to control. Any help would be greatly appreciated.

18"=16" in norco sizingBigAl
Sep 4, 2001 3:48 PM
I'm 6'1" and I have the second smallest frame available (out of 5 sizes). I tried the medium size, and it just didnt flow as nicely as the smaller one. I say, if your shorter than me, dont get any larger than the 18" for freeride.
